In this issue you’ll hear leadership tips and takeaways from Winter Business Meetings, learn strategies from four Illinois REALTORS® on how to develop winning habits that will help you build your business and get the information you need to be ready for the 2023 Managing Broker license renewal deadline in April. The Illinois REALTORS® Legal Hotline Attorney answers the question of how long you need to keep business paperwork. And as part of Black History Month, we take a closer look at the National Association of Real Estate Brokers annual report on the state of Black homeownership in the U.S.
